WebMar 31, 2024 · Surfgrass is an angiosperm with true leaves, stems, and rootstocks; not an alga. P. scouleri leaf blades are characteristically flat and wide (2-4 mm) reaching no longer than 3 feet in length. Leaves arise from a congested rhizotomous base and flowers are found near the base on short stalks (1-6 cm).
